Hello - I am looking to buy a better quality turntable to be able to 1 - listen to my collection and 2 - put my collection on to itunes. I have around 700 LP's from the 1980's that have never been played. I had a good friend with the same music taste (and same collection) and we recorded cassettes off of his LP's. I really miss the sound of vinyl compared to CD's and am looking to buy a higher end (my budget is $1500) turntable with a good cartridge.
I've called some dealers in my area (there aren't many who sell turntables here) and here are my choices:
Rega , Project Audio and Music Hall.

I'd really appreciate any advice that you could pass my way. Looking forward to learning more from this forum.

Sorry slipperybidness, was so excited to get a response I messed up your name :) After visiting the stores in the area I've decided on the Rega RP6 - I have one question, should I go with the Ortofon 2m Bronze or the 2M Black?
The 2M black.

There is a Thorens 125 turntable on Ebay right now with an SME series 2 improved arm. This unit will best anything on your short list by a wide margin. You will still have enough money to buy the 2M Ortofon Black and be in budget.
